She has a degree in Social Sciences from the Federal University of Rio Grande do Norte (2012) and a master's degree in Social Anthropology - University of Costa Rica (2019). She currently has a PhD in social anthropology from PPGAS/UFRN at the Federal University of Rio Grande do Norte. She has experience in the area of ​​Anthropology, with an emphasis on Indigenous Ethnology, working mainly on the following themes: indigenous women, epistemologies, anthropology, community feminism, territorial recovery. She works in the research group on New Social Cartography in the Rio Grande do Norte nucleus. Other topics of interest: performance, resistance in capoeira Angola and the role of women.
